TURN YOUR ANAMORPHIC LENS INTO A CLOSE-FOCUS BEAST – Anamorphic video lenses, by design, are inherently bad at focusing close to your subject. Diopters are the cinematographers best kept secret at capturing tightly framed close-ups of faces and environmental details while maintaining that wide lens perspective.
STACK MULTIPLE FILTERS FOR A EXTREME MACRO LOOK – Each filter has front filter threads allowing photographers to stack the filters on top of one another. Combine the +1 and +2 to achieve a +3 or Combine a + 2 and +4 for a combined +6 diopter effect. A visual vignette may occur depending on how wide the original lens is but that can increase the overall creative look of the final image.
